About Wolfram Ziegler
Wolfram Ziegler is a scholar working on Cognitive Neuroscience, Developmental and Educational Psychology, Experimental and Cognitive Psychology, Speech and Hearing and Physiology, having authored 171 papers that have together received 3.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Neurobiology of Language and Bilingualism (75 papers), Voice and Speech Disorders (57 papers), Phonetics and Phonology Research (46 papers), Language Development and Disorders (40 papers), Dysphagia Assessment and Management (24 papers), Stuttering Research and Treatment (19 papers), Action Observation and Synchronization (13 papers) and Reading and Literacy Development (11 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Experimental and Cognitive Psychology (1.3k citations), Cognitive Neuroscience (1.9k citations), Developmental and Educational Psychology (1.2k citations), Speech and Hearing (411 citations) and Developmental Biology (98 citations). Wolfram Ziegler has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Hermann Ackermann, Ingrid Aichert, D. von Cramon, Anja Staiger, Theresa Schölderle, Bettina Brendel, Steffen R. Hage, Dagmar Timmann, Karl Wessel and Georg Goldenberg. Their work appears in journals such as Aphasiology, Journal of Speech Language and Hearing Research, Brain and Language, Clinical Linguistics & Phonetics and Neuropsychologia.
